I've discovered that many people, especially non-Europeans, think it's the same language. It's not strange. Modern culture is not as advertised as ancient culture. When people hear "Greek", they hear "Plato".
September 16, 2025 at 11:30 AM
Because we're taught ancient Greek at school, it's not impossible to understand a large portion of the text, but you can't expect a good "translation" from the average person. Older people who know Katharevousa will have an easier time.
September 16, 2025 at 10:44 AM
The core mechanics are similar, but people will struggle with grammar patterns, "short words" and meanings that have evolved or disappeared.
